From 211b1cd63400ef7292acf13f9d5e13ca01a1a5d6 Mon Sep 17 00:00:00 2001 From: Alexander Couzens Date: Fri, 23 Feb 2024 22:43:22 +0100 Subject: [PATCH] osmo_epdg: ue: fixup leaking enumerators --- src/libcharon/plugins/osmo_epdg/osmo_epdg_ue.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/src/libcharon/plugins/osmo_epdg/osmo_epdg_ue.c b/src/libcharon/plugins/osmo_epdg/osmo_epdg_ue.c index d65d9000d..66719f8c8 100644 --- a/src/libcharon/plugins/osmo_epdg/osmo_epdg_ue.c +++ b/src/libcharon/plugins/osmo_epdg/osmo_epdg_ue.c @@ -255,6 +255,7 @@ METHOD(osmo_epdg_ue_t, generate_pco, int, { *pco = NULL; *pco_len = 0; + enumerator->destroy(enumerator); return 0; } @@ -297,6 +298,7 @@ METHOD(osmo_epdg_ue_t, generate_pco, int, } } *pco_len = iter; + enumerator->destroy(enumerator); return 0; }